An Evolutionary Comparison of the Handicap Principle and Hybrid Equilibrium Theories of Signaling
Fig 5
A simplex indicating the probability of evolving to the handicap-signaling equilibrium, hybrid equilibrium, or some other outcome in a randomly chosen Sir Philip Sidney game.
Each point represents one random setting of the parameter values. Its location in the simplex indicates the size of the basin of attraction for the various outcomes. The size of the basin of attraction is inversely proportional to its distance from the vertex. For example, if the point is close to the lower right vertex, this indicates that the basin of attraction for the hybrid equilibrium is significantly larger than for the other two outcomes.
